## Wavecrest Preview Environments

Hey plugin folks! The Wavecrest audio waveform preview service runs in three environments: sandbox, staging, and prod. Sandbox is what you want — it regenerates previews on every upload, so you can hammer it without annoying anyone. Staging mirrors prod rendering settings but with looser rate limits. Prod access requires sign-off from the Tidegate team.

Note that peak resolution and downsample settings differ per environment. For reference, sandbox currently runs with the following configuration:

config for tagep-yajef:
ulawyn:
  log_level: error
  metrics_host: metrics.ulawyn.lumiclabs.internal
  pin: 0564
  pool_size: 32

Quick note on VramScope, the GPU memory profiler we license from Hollowpine Systems. Renewal lands each March; pricing is per-seat, and we're at 12 seats. Their sampling agent needs updating whenever we bump driver versions, so budget a half day for that. Support has been responsive — usually same-day turnaround on profiling bugs. For contract questions or seat changes, their account contact for us is reachable below.

alerts address for bajop-yahog: istwyn@lumiclabs.internal

Welcome to Shrinkwrap, our CLI for batch image resizing! As release manager you'll mostly run it before cutting a build, to squash the asset folder down to something the Pebbleworth CDN won't choke on. Install it with the bootstrap script, then create a `.shrinkwrap.env` in the repo root. Most defaults are fine — output format, max dimensions, concurrency — so you can leave those alone. The only thing the tool truly requires is the upload credential, which goes on the first line of that file.

vault entry, kagep-yajeg: COURIER_KEY5=da097

Leadership Review Briefing — Insurance Renewal

Quick update for the board: our property and liability cover with Harwick Mutual comes up for renewal at the end of next quarter. Premiums are tracking up roughly 9% across the market, but our broker thinks we can hold the increase near 5% given our clean claims record at the Delverton site. We'll bring final terms to the May session. One factor shapes our negotiating position, and it stays in this room.

management briefing: Headcount on the Quenael team goes from 9 to 80 by the end of July. Gross margin on Quenael came in at 15 percent against a plan of 20 percent.